>> I am currently writing a DITA Task topic.  Within a <step> element you can 
>> insert a <choicetable> element, which in turn can contain <chrow> elements, 
>> representing a row in a special two-column table.  When you insert the 
>> <chrow> element, Serna thoughtfully also inserts the two obligatory cell 
>> elements, <choption> and <chdesc>.
>> 
>> Trouble is, in Show Markup mode, the <chrow> element is suppressed for some 
>> reason.  It is nigh impossible to place the cursor to insert the next 
>> <chrow> element.  I have tried in the Show Markup and Hide Markup views, 
>> and the Content Map outline, but for some reason the cursor finishes up 
>> within the <step> element but never within the <choicetable> element after 
>> the previous <chrow>.  I prefer to try and keep in the document window and 
>> use the mouse as little as possible when entering content inititally.  But 
>> this inconvenience prevent that way of working.
>> 
>> Is anyone else experiencing this annoyance/bug?
